Tension cells are used for measurement of a straight-line force ‘pulling apart’ along a single axis; typically annotated as the positive force. The height of the liquid in the tube above any point in the fluid indicates the pressure of the liquid at that point. A pyrometer is a device for measuring very high temperatures and uses the principle that all substances emit radiant energy when hot, the rate of emission depending on their temperature. Show Explanation The shape of the elastic element used in load cells depends on a number of factors, including the range of force to be measured, dimensional limits, final performance, and production costs. Total radiation pyrometers are used to measure temperature in the range 700°C to 2000°C. The piezometer, when used for the measurement of pressure in a pipe in which fluid is flowing, must be kept such that the axis of the tube is normal to the direction of flow.
